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SMB/TRANSLATION -
Message number: 021
Message text: Specify personalization ID and reference activity

- Specify personalization ID and reference activity ?The SAP error message
/SMB/TRANSLATION021
indicates that a personalization ID and reference activity must be specified in the context of a translation or personalization task. This error typically arises when a user attempts to access a translation or personalization function without providing the necessary identifiers.Cause:
- Missing Personalization ID: The user has not specified a personalization ID, which is required to identify the specific personalization settings.
- Missing Reference Activity: The reference activity, which links the personalization ID to a specific task or function, is not provided.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the translation or personalization settings in the SAP system.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:
Specify Personalization ID:
- Ensure that you enter a valid personalization ID when prompted. This ID should correspond to the personalization settings you wish to apply.
Specify Reference Activity:
- Along with the personalization ID, make sure to provide the reference activity that relates to the personalization. This could be a transaction code or a specific activity within the SAP system.
Check Configuration:
- Review the configuration settings for the translation or personalization functionality in your SAP system. Ensure that all necessary parameters are correctly set up.
Consult Documentation:
-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for guidance on how to properly set up and use personalization IDs and reference activities.
Contact Support:
- If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ting SAP Notes for any known issues related to this error message.
